People who are dating often want to find out quickly whether or not a relationship is worth spending time developing. Especially if you are meeting people on line, being confronted with a bewildering number of choices can be very confusing. It’s not always easy to weed out those who are going to be unsuitable, because everyone puts their best foot forward at the outset.

 

If you want a quick way to separate the sheep from the goats, here’s a tip: TURN UP THE HEAT. What does this mean? It means, find out how they behave under pressure. Things often go along fine until the first sign of trouble, and then when faced with a bit of a problem, people’s true colors show through. They drop their masks and reveal who they REALLY are.

 

To short circuit the process, test it out early on, before you’ve wasted huge amounts of time dating Mr. Wrong. Find opportunities to observe how they behave when the heat is turned up. Here are some examples:

 

  1. What are they like when driving? Do they swear and get impatient with other drivers?
  2. If you spill a drink in a restaurant do they seem irritated with you rather than treating it as a simple mishap?
  3. If you disagree with them, do they get hot under the collar and start attacking you rather than the issue?

Pay close attention also to how they treat others. Someone who is discourteous to the waitress will eventually be discourteous to you. Don’t make excuses for them. How they are now is how they will always be. If you don’t like it now, you won’t like it later. Better to bow out gracefully before your feelings become too deeply involved and spare yourself a lot of heartache.
